Buse Sinlak
Buse Sinlak is our inbound student from Izmir, Turkey (Izmir’s is Turkeys 3rd largest city and has the second most important port in Turkey. It is on the west coast of Turkey on the Agean Sea, east of Greece. It's population is 2.5 million +/- and 5 million in the provence. It is 360 mi from Instanbul- learn more). Buse has worked in student government, was head of the dicipline comittee, was in debate, worked for the student newspaper (in english), worked for student court, student goverment and council. She was a ballerina for 9 yearsand 1st in lzmir and 4th in Turkey. She loves listening music, watching movies, dancing in an aerobic dance group and acting. Her favorite author is Ayse Kulin. Her mother is a physical education teacher and girls basketbal coach at Buse's school (lzmir Ozel Turk Koleji) and her father is a contractor. Like most in her county, she is Muslim. 11. Describe what you do at your school. (e.g., How many subjects do you take? What are they? How long are the classes? What is your daily schedule during your school year? Start with your wake?up time and discuss only one typical day's schedule.) If you have course choices at your school, tell what and why you chose as you did.

11 -)In Turkey we have departments at school. For example i am in a language department. I take 11 subjects at school , these are; english ewspaper British and American literaure, english grammer, german, religion, physicaI education, geography, history, psychology, nationaI security, turkish literature. Each class is 45 minutes.1 want to tell my friday school schedule to you.I wake up at 8:00 in the morning and go to school. First class starts at 8:45.F irst lessons are generally english and geography then we have p.e lessons, we go and change our clothes and play games and dance in p.e  lessons. And we have german, and after german we have english literature. We have 8 lessons everyday. After 8 lesson we go to our schools garden and sing our national song after ceremony i go to class again because i teach english to public school students volunteerly because they dont have enough english lessons at their school. I go to classes and teach them what they need and go to home at 5:00pm.
